포럼

왜 자유 소프트웨어가 오픈 소스보다 좋은가?

몇몇 자유 소프트웨어 개발자들은 ``자유 소프트웨어''라는 용어 대신 ``오픈 소스 소프트웨어''라는 용어를 사용하기 시작했습니다. 자유 소프트웨어가 다른 이름으로 지칭된다고 해도 여러분에게 똑같은 자유를 주겠지만, 사용하는 이름에 따라서 의미상의 큰 차이를 만들게 됩니다. 왜냐하면 다른 단어의 사용은 다른 의미를 전달하기 때문입니다.

이 글은 왜 "오픈 소스"라는 용어의 사용이 어떠한 문제들도 해결하지 못하며 오히려 문제를 발생시킬 수 있는지에 대해서 설명합니다. 또한, "자유 소프트웨어"라는 용어의 사용을 고수하는 것이 더욱 바람직한 이유들을 설명합니다.

받아들일 수 없는 제한들
``오픈 소스 소프트웨어''는 "자유 소프트웨어"와 흡사하지만 완전히 동일하지는 않은소프트웨어 라이센스의 한 종류입니다. ``오픈 소스 소프트웨어''를 인정하기로 결정한 사람들은 받아들일 수 없는 제한 사항들이 포함된 라이센스에 동의한 것과 같습니다. 여기에 대해서는 애플 라이센스의 문제점을 참고하시기 바랍니다.

의미의 모호성
``자유 소프트웨어''라는 용어는 모호성의 문제를 가지고 있습니다. 본래 의도했던 "사용자에게 어떤 자유(自由, freedom)를 선사하는 소프트웨어"라는 의미 뿐만 아니라, 의도했던 바가 아닌 ``무료(無料, zero price)로 얻을 수 있는 소프트웨어"라는 의미도 갖고 있습니다. 우리는 이 문제를 자유 소프트웨어란 무엇인가라는 글에 설명해 놓았지만, 이것이 완벽한 해결책은 아닙니다. 즉, 이 문제는 결코 완벽하게 해결될 수 없습니다. 모호성을 최대한 없앤 용어를 사용하는 것이 최선의 방법입니다.


....... 중략

출처 : http://www.gnu.org/philosophy/free-software-for-freedom.ko.html

그외 : http://www.gnu.org/philosophy/philosophy.ko.html


예전에 얼핏 읽은 기억이 있는데 한국갈때 misol님이 진행하려하는 모임 때문에 무슨 이야기를 할까 생각하다가 우연히 발견 되었습니다. 그냥 생각하고 있다가 나중에 가서 이야기 꺼내볼까 했는데 막상 제대로 읽어보니 현재 이곳에서 이야기하는 유형의 사람, 기업들이 이 문서에 전부 설명되어있습니다.


시간나시는 분들은 꼭 정독해보시고 이제까지 자신은 어느쪽이었는지 되짚어보시기 바랍니다.